Real Muthaphuckkin G's-Eazy E



This is the second track of the EP It’s On (Dr. Dre) 187um Killa, an entire EP dedicated to dissing ex-N.W.A. mate Dr. Dre in response to Dre Day.


It is one of the most important diss tracks in hip-hop history. Eazy-E, flanked by Ruthless Records homies Gangsta Dresta and B. G. Knoccout, beats up on his former ally Dr. Dre and his new Death Row posse. Eazy remarks that Dr. Dre is being “treated like bootcamp” by his boss Suge Knight who memorably forced Vanilla Ice to sign a contract by hanging him out of a window. Eazy calls Snoop Doggy Dogg, who joined Dre in dissing Eazy on the track “Fuck Wit Dre Day”, an ‘anorexic rapper’ for his boney frame.


The track samples “Eazy-Duz-It” by Eazy-E and “It’s Funky Enough” by D.O.C., both produced by Dr. Dre. The line, “Dre Day only meant Eazy’s pay day”, subtly revealed to the public that Eazy had a contractual agreement with Dr. Dre from his days with Ruthless Records which forced his new label to pay Eazy a small percentage of all Dr. Dre record sales for 6 years, even the one’s that dissed him.


As if the lyrics were not enough, the crew Eazy got to appear in the video — including former NWA members MC Ren and DJ Yella — added legitimacy to Compton’s turn on Dre.
